EIMD-10CP Condensate Polishing Module with 16 MΩ*cm Resistivity and 90-95% Recovery Using Continuous Electrodeionization

The Aquacells EIMD-CP module is engineered to replace mixed bed technology for condensate polishing treatment. Utilizing continuous electrodeionization (EDI) technology, this system produces water with resistivity exceeding 16 MΩ·cm without requiring shutdown and regeneration cycles.

Feed Water Specifications
Parameter Specification
Feed Water Source Condensate water
Temperature 60-65 ℃ (140-149 ℉)
Feed Pressure 1.4-7 bar (20-100 psi)
Fe Content <0.01 ppm
pH Range 4-11
Oil Content <0.2 ppm
Typical Module Performance
Parameter Performance
Typical Recovery 90-95%
Maximum Feed Pressure 7 bar (100 psi)
Maximum Feed Temperature 65 ℃ (149 ℉)
DC Voltage* 0-300 V
DC Amperage 0-6 A
Product Resistivity >16 MΩ·cm

*Voltage required depends on module size
